Horace Grant

Horace Junior Grant ( born July 4, 1965 in Augusta, Georgia, United States ) is a former American professional basketball player for the Chicago Bulls, Orlando Magic, Seattle Supersonics and Los Angeles Lakers in the NBA. The 2.08 meter tall Grant played the positions of the power forward and center, and later won with the Bulls three times ( 1991-1993) and with the Lakers once ( 2001) the NBA championship.

Career

Grant was pulled by the Bulls in the NBA Draft in 1987 at 10th place. He was replacement of power forward Charles Oakley and came per game on a good 22 minutes of the game. After Oakley was wegtransferiert next year for center Bill Cartwright, Grant became the starting power forward and was consistently good for 12 points and 8 rebounds per game. He won four NBA Championships and was praised for his hard work as a defense " General Grant ." Total Grant was four times elected to the " All-Defensive team," the best defensive player.

1994 Grant was transferred to the Orlando Magic of center -Star Shaquille O'Neal. As a power forward at the O'Neal's side once he reached the NBA Finals, but could not prevent the 0-4 debacle against the Houston Rockets. The Magic transferred him in 1999 to the Seattle SuperSonics before he changed it one year at the Los Angeles Lakers and again Sekundant of O'Neal was. With LA Grant won his fourth championship title before he went for two years back to Orlando. In 2003 he joined after an unsuccessful second year in Orlando, once again to the Lakers and ended 2004 at the age of 39 years of his career.

Grant was known throughout his career for his large wraparound perspex glasses.

Private life

Horace Grant is the twin brother of Harvey Grant, also played in the NBA.
